Giuseppe Contratto founded his winery in 1867 when he began vinifying Moscato wine from Monferrato, producing one of the first Italian sparkling wines refermented in the bottle. During this same time, the Contratto family began building its historic cellars, which would finally be finished at the beginning of the 20th century.
Around 1910 Contratto began to export their wines. Contratto had great success in foreign markets, and the winery became synonymous with prestige and quality in the world of sparkling wines, so much so that the winery became the official wine supplier for the Vatican, the Belgian Royal Family, and in 1913 the Royal Family of Savoy. In 1919 Contratto produced its first vintage Italian sparkling, an innovative choice on the part of the Piedmontese sparkling house that aimed to highlight a single vintage's characteristics.
The Contratto family remained at the company's helm until 1993, when the Bocchino family, who owned a distillery of the same name, took the reigns of Contratto. The Bocchino family set forth the work of restoring the Wine Cathedral, the internal courtyard, and the tasting room.
Giorgio Rivetti, a huge fan of Champagne, began collaborating with the Bocchino family and immediately realized the great potential of the historic sparkling house. Shortly after, in 2011, the Rivetti family decided to take an important step and purchased the winery. This new project immediately reflects the philosophy and passion that made La Spinetta famous. A fundamental decision was directly taken: acquiring several hectares of land, some under vine, close to the little town of Bossolaso. Situated in the highest part of the Langhe, the Bossolasco zone lends itself perfectly to the cultivation of Pinot Noir and Chardonnay. These grapes are used in the production of the Alta Langa DOCG. This marks the official entry of Contratto in the Consortium of Alta Langa, and Contratto becomes the reference point for the entire denomination.
